伞形膜结构组合屋盖风荷载特性的风洞试验研究 被引量:4

Experimental investigation of wind loads on umbrella-shaped membrane assembled roofs

摘要 结合井冈山机场航站楼的风洞试验 ,分析了伞形膜结构组合屋盖平均风压与脉动风压的分布特性 ,并从平均风压与脉动风压相关性的分析中讨论了准定常理论的适用性 ,同时探讨了脉动风压的概率分布 ,并对峰值因子的取值提出了建议 ,论文提出对不同紊流区应分别对待的观点 。 Based on the wind tunnel test for Waiting Building of Jinggangshan Airport, the mean and fluctuating wind pressure coefficient distribution on the umbrella-shaped membrane assembled roof was studied and the applicability of quasi-steady theory is discussed by correlation analysis of the mean and fluctuating pressure on the same point with variable azimuths and on variable points with the same azimuth. Meanwhile, the probability distribution of fluctuating wind pressure coefficient is discussed and the determination of the peak factors for estimating the max positive wind pressure and the max negative wind pressure is suggested. The viewpoint that zones with different turbulivity should be distinguished is presented, and the rules which can guide global and partial wind-resistance design of general umbrella-shaped membrane assembled roofs are obtained.
